大约一周前,我在我的计算机上成功安装了 golang
并获得了要处理的终端命令。因此,我知道我的电脑上有 go。
我一直在寻找一个好的 IDE 并找到了 https://code.google.com/p/liteide/ LiteIDE 专为 Go 开发。
我读到如果您已经在您的计算机上安装了 go,那么您可以使用 LiteIDE 立即开始构建您的代码。我一定是在某些地方读错了,因为我根本无法构建我的项目。我认为可能存在丢失/不正确的路径,或者某些设置不正确。
这是我在控制台中得到的错误:
Current environment change id "win64-user"
C:/go/bin/go.exe env [c:\go]
set GOARCH=amd64
set GOBIN=
set GOCHAR=6
set GOEXE=.exe
set GOHOSTARCH=amd64
set GOHOSTOS=windows
set GOOS=windows
set GOPATH=
set GORACE=
set GOROOT=c:\go
set GOTOOLDIR=c:\go\pkg\tool\windows_amd64
set TERM=dumb
set CC=gcc
set GOGCCFLAGS=-g -O2 -m64 -mthreads
set CXX=g++
set CGO_ENABLED=1
Command exited with code 0.
First_Lite_Go_Proj [C:/go/src/First Litel Go Proj]
Error: process failed to start.
我检查了 C:/go 目录以确保那里的所有内容都是正确的。我也使用 64 位 Windows 7 并仔细检查了它。
有什么想法吗?我的是:缺少/不正确的路径,由于限制无法访问某个目录。
最佳答案
虽然我没有在 Windows 7 上测试过,但在 Windows 10 上,这些是我为使 LiteIDE 工作而采取的步骤
- 已安装转到
C:\Go
- 将
C:\Go\bin
添加到PATH
并确保go
从命令行运行 - 这对我来说是最重要的一步。在环境变量中定义了
GOPATH
。在我的例子中,它是C:\Users\vivek\Documents\Source\Go
。我还确保在 GOPATH 中创建了三个文件夹src
、pkg
和bin
。此时go env
向我显示了GOPATH
和GOROOT
的正确值。go get
、go build
和go install
在此步骤中同样有效。 - 下载 LiteIDE 并将其解压缩到 C:\liteide。启动 LiteIDE,它对我来说开箱即用。通过转到
View > Manage GOPATH
确保 LiteIDE 正确看到
GOPATH
希望这对您有所帮助。祝你好运。
关于ide - LiteIDE 构建后无法运行代码,进程启动失败,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23356189/